| The 2002 Perl Advent Calendar |
| posted by pudge on Sunday December 01, @16:15 (modules) |
| http://use.perl.org/article.pl?sid=02/12/01/2057219 |
+--------------------------------------------------------------------+
[0]2shortplanks writes "Doesn't December come round quickly? Announcing
the [1]third Perl Advent Calendar, the Advent calendar that features a
different Perl module each day of Advent, and a bonus module on Christmas
day. This year's improvements include each day having its own
mini-tutorial attached, and much better HTML."
